Detoxification is the first part of getting off of alcohol and drugs, and you can decide to go through detoxification in a hospital inpatient detoxification facility for a few reasons. Hospital inpatient detoxification in Carversville provides medical detox, which is conducted with the assistance of nurses and physicians who can make detoxification more comfortable, utilizing medications to ease symptoms and make detox safer. A person detoxing from alcohol for example might benefit from specific medications during detox to prevent seizures and tremors that commonly occur during serious alcohol withdrawal. A person who is experiencing heroin or prescription opioid withdrawal will most likely choose to take part in medically supervised detox in a hospital inpatient facility, where medications are administered to help them through a very miserable (but usually not life threatening) form of withdrawal. Patients in a hospital inpatient detoxification facility stay at the facility until the withdrawal symptoms have subsided. This could be anywhere from 1 to 2 weeks depending on what drug they are withdrawing from and their overall health.

For an individual who has been struggling with substance abuse issues for some time, there would ideally be an immediate and easy transition from a hospital inpatient detoxification facility to a drug and/or alcohol recovery center to treat their addiction because detox is not rehabilitation in itself.
